I upgraded our Jazz server from 1.0 to 1.0.1 using IBM Installation Manager but the "Server Status Summary" from the Web UI still says "Server Version 1.0 (I20080618-1642)". I must be missing some step(s).
My server is Windows 2003 Server using WAS/DB2 and I used these steps:

- 1) stop and uninstalled jazz.war in WAS
2) removed jazz.war from file system
3) stop WAS
4) upgraded Jazz (1.0 -> 1.0.1) using IBM Installation Manager
5) started WAS
6) installed new jazz.war and configured LDAP groups mapping)
7) started jazz.war
8) logged into web ui (as admin) and checked Server->Status Summary

I think you've forgotten one step. Before you started the upgrade, you
should have requested a "server reset" by visiting the URL:
https://<hostname>:9443/jazz/admin?internal#action=com.ibm.team.repository.admin.serverReset
and clicking "Request Server Reset"
At this point (after completing the other steps in the upgrade),
clicking that button and then restarting the Jazz application should
still work.
You can find the upgrade process in our docs, under:
Installing and upgrading -> Installing Rational Team Concert ->
Upgrading to Rational Team Concert 1.0.1
